
Hvad er ASCII Tegn?
Definition af ASCII
ASCII, som står for American Standard Code for Information Interchange, er et karakterkodningssystem, der bruges til at repræsentere tekst i computere og kommunikationsudstyr. ASCII tegn omfatter et sæt af 128 tegn, der inkluderer både kontroltegn og printable tegn. Hver karakter i ASCII-koderingen får tildelt et numerisk værdi fra 0 til 127, hvilket gør det muligt for computere at forstå og kommunikere med tekst.
Historien bag ASCII Tegn
ASCII blev udviklet i tidlige 1960’ere som et standardiseret sæt tegn, der kunne anvendes på tværs af forskellige computere og systemer. Det blev først accepteret som en standard i 1968 og har siden været grundlaget for mange moderne kodningssystemer. På det tidspunkt var det en revolutionerende idé at have et fælles sprog for computerkommunikation, og ASCII tegn blev hurtigt en del af den digitale revolution.
Betydningen af ASCII Tegn i moderne teknologi
I dag er ASCII tegn stadig relevante, selv om de fleste systemer i stigende grad bruger mere komplekse tegnsæt som Unicode. ASCII’s enkelhed og effektivitet gør det ideelt til kommunikation i mange forskellige applikationer, inklusive programmering, datakommunikation og webudvikling. Mange protokoller og softwaresystemer bygger stadig på ASCII standarden, hvilket sikrer, at det forbliver en vigtig del af den teknologiske infrastruktur.
Typer af ASCII Tegn
Kontroltegn
Kontroltegn er en del af ASCII, der ikke repræsenterer synlige symboler, men snarere bruges til at styre, hvordan data behandles. Eksempler på kontroltegn inkluderer nul (ASCII værdi 0), linjeskift (ASCII værdi 10) og tabe (ASCII værdi 9). Disse tegn er essentielle i datakommunikation og programmering, da de hjælper med at formatere tekst og styre datastrømme.
Printable ASCII Tegn
Printable ASCII tegn spænder fra ASCII værdi 32 til 126 og inkluderer bogstaver, tal og speciale tegn. Dette omfatter store og små bogstaver (A-Z, a-z), tal (0-9) samt forskellige symboler som @, # og $. Disse tegn er de mest anvendte i tekstbehandling og softwareudvikling, da de udgør grundlaget for al menneskelig læsbar tekst.
Udvidede ASCII Tegn
Mens den originale ASCII standard kun indeholder 128 tegn, blev der udviklet udvidede versioner, der indeholder op til 256 tegn. Disse udvidede ASCII tegn inkluderer almindelige tegn fra forskellige sprog og specialtegn, der kan være nødvendige i global kommunikation. Disse udvidelser har gjort det muligt for ASCII at tilpasse sig en bredere vifte af anvendelser og sprog.
Hvordan ASCII Tegn Anvendes
ASCII Tegn i Programmering
Programmeringssprog som Python, C++ og Java anvender ASCII tegn til at skrive kode. De gør brug af de printable ASCII tegn til at skabe variabelnavne, funktioner og kommentarer. Desuden anvendes kontroltegn til at strukturere og formatere koden, hvilket gør det lettere at læse og forstå.
ASCII Tegn i Datakommunikation
ASCII tegn spiller en afgørende rolle i datakommunikation, især inden for netværk og protokoller. Når data sendes over internettet eller andre netværk, bliver de ofte oversat til ASCII for at sikre, at de kan forstås af modtageren. Dette sikrer, at data kan overføres effektivt og uden fejl.
Brug af ASCII Tegn i Webudvikling
Webudviklere bruger ofte ASCII tegn i HTML og CSS til at oprette strukturerede webindhold. ASCII tegn som ‘<‘ og ‘>‘ er essentielle for at definere HTML-tags, mens andre tegn bruges til at formatere indhold. ASCII sikrer, at websider vises korrekt på tværs af forskellige browsere.
ASCII Tegn og deres kodesystem
Kodetabeller for ASCII Tegn
ASCII tegn repræsenteres i kodetabeller, som angiver hvilken numerisk værdi der svarer til hvert tegn. Dette gør det muligt for programmerere og udviklere at forstå og anvende ASCII tegn korrekt. Du kan finde kodetabeller online, der viser de 128 standard ASCII tegn og deres respektive værdier.
Hvordan man læser ASCII Koder
At læse ASCII koder kræver, at man kender den numeriske værdi for hvert tegn. For eksempel, hvis du ser tallet 65, ved du, at det svarer til bogstavet ‘A’. Dette system gør det muligt at konvertere mellem tekst og numeriske værdier, hvilket er en vigtig del af databehandling.
ASCII Tegn i Kunst og Design
ASCII Kunst: En introduktion
ASCII kunst er en form for grafisk repræsentation, hvor billeder skabes ved hjælp af ASCII tegn. Dette kan være alt fra simple smiley ansigt til komplekse billeder, der kræver stor kreativitet og teknisk dygtighed. ASCII kunst opstod i de tidlige dage af computeren, hvor grafik var begrænset, og det blev en populær måde at udtrykke sig på.
Eksempler på ASCII Kunst
Der findes mange fantastiske eksempler på ASCII kunst, der spænder fra enkle designs til komplekse billeder. Du kan finde ASCII kunst i mange online fællesskaber, hvor kunstnere deler deres værker. Nogle populære stilarter inkluderer portrætter, dyremotiver og abstrakte designs, alle lavet udelukkende med ASCII tegn.
Værktøjer til at skabe ASCII Kunst
Der er flere værktøjer til rådighed online, der kan hjælpe dig med at skabe din egen ASCII kunst. Programmer som JavE (Java ASCII Versatile Editor) og ASCII Art Studio giver brugerne mulighed for at tegne og redigere deres egne designs ved hjælp af ASCII tegn. Disse værktøjer gør det lettere at eksperimentere med forskellige stilarter og skabe unikke værker.
Fremtidige Udsigter for ASCII Tegn
Er ASCII Tegn stadig relevante?
På trods af udviklingen af mere komplekse tegnsæt som Unicode, forbliver ASCII tegn relevante. De bruges stadig i mange applikationer og systemer, da deres enkelhed og effektivitet gør dem til en pålidelig løsning til tekstbehandling og datakommunikation.
Alternativer til ASCII Tegn
Mens ASCII er en favorit blandt mange udviklere, er der alternativer som Unicode, der tilbyder et meget bredere tegnsæt. Unicode understøtter flere sprog og symboler, hvilket gør det til et populært valg for global kommunikation. Men selv med disse alternativer er ASCII stadig fundamentet for mange af de systemer, der er i brug i dag.
Konklusion om fremtiden for ASCII Tegn
ASCII tegn vil sandsynligvis forblive en vigtig del af den digitale verden i overskuelig fremtid. Selvom teknologien udvikler sig, og nye standarder introduceres, vil den grundlæggende struktur og funktion af ASCII sikre, at det forbliver relevant for både udviklere og brugere.
Ofte Stillede Spørgsmål om ASCII Tegn
Hvad er forskellen mellem ASCII og Unicode?
ASCII er et 7-bit tegnsæt med 128 tegn, mens Unicode er et 16-bit og 32-bit tegnsæt, der kan rumme millioner af tegn fra forskellige sprog og symboler. ASCII er begrænset til det engelske alfabet, mens Unicode understøtter global kommunikation.
Hvordan kan man konvertere mellem ASCII Tegn og andre tegnsæt?
Der er mange online værktøjer og software, der kan hjælpe med at konvertere mellem ASCII og andre tegnsæt. For eksempel kan du bruge online konvertere, der gør det muligt at indtaste tekst og få ASCII koderingen, eller omvendt.
Hvor kan man finde en komplet liste over ASCII Tegn?
En komplet liste over ASCII tegn kan findes på mange websites, der specialiserer sig i programmering og computerrelaterede emner. Disse lister viser de 128 standard ASCII tegn og deres respektive numeriske værdier, hvilket gør det lettere at referere til dem i udvikling.